Skip to content

Commit 9800c34

Browse files
authored
[Interp] Mark inline-virtual.cpp as unsupported with ASan (#135402)
See #135401 for the full flakiness report. It fails on stage2/asan_ubsan check with: ``` + /home/b/sanitizer-x86_64-linux-fast/build/llvm_build_asan_ubsan/bin/clang-repl -Xcc -fno-rtti -Xcc -fno-sized-deallocation JIT session error: In graph incr_module_23-jitted-objectbuffer, section .text.startup: relocation target "_ZN1AD2Ev" at address 0x79618c48d040 is out of range of Delta32 fixup at 0x75618b40d02d (<anonymous block> @ 0x75618b40d010 + 0x1d) error: Failed to materialize symbols: { (main, { $.incr_module_23.__inits.0, __orc_init_func.incr_module_23, a2 }) } error: Failed to materialize symbols: { (main, { __orc_init_func.incr_module_23 }) } The error message ("out of range of Delta32") appears similar to #102858, another Interpreter test that is flaky with ASan. ``` Recent test history on the x86_64-linux-fast bot: - https://lab.llvm.org/buildbot/#/builders/169/builds/10339: fail - 10340: buildbot logistical problem - https://lab.llvm.org/buildbot/#/builders/169/builds/10341: fail - https://lab.llvm.org/buildbot/#/builders/169/builds/10342: fail - 10343: pass - 10344: pass - https://lab.llvm.org/buildbot/#/builders/169/builds/10345: fail - 10346: pass ...
1 parent 1175f5b commit 9800c34

File tree

1 file changed

+3
-0
lines changed

1 file changed

+3
-0
lines changed

clang/test/Interpreter/inline-virtual.cpp

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,9 @@
11
// REQUIRES: host-supports-jit
22
// UNSUPPORTED: system-aix
33
//
4+
// This test is flaky with ASan: https://github.com/llvm/llvm-project/issues/135401
5+
// UNSUPPORTED: asan
6+
//
47
// We disable RTTI to avoid problems on Windows for non-RTTI builds of LLVM
58
// where the JIT cannot find ??_7type_info@@6B@.
69
// RUN: cat %s | clang-repl -Xcc -fno-rtti -Xcc -fno-sized-deallocation \

0 commit comments

Comments
 (0)